Compare all specifications:

2006 Ford Five Hundred 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K
Make Ford Mercedes-Benz
Model Five Hundred CLK
Year Released 2006 2005
Body Type Sedan Convertible
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3001 cc 1796 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 203 HP 168 HP
Engine RPM 5750 RPM 5500 RPM
Torque 281 Nm 240 Nm
Torque RPM 4500 RPM 3000 RPM
Engine Bore Size 88.9 mm 82 mm
Engine Stroke Size 78.7 mm 85 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 10.0:1 10.0:1
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line - Premium
Drive Type AWD Rear
Number of Seats 5 seats 4 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 2856 kg 1665 kg
Vehicle Length 5100 mm 4640 mm
Vehicle Width 1900 mm 1750 mm
Vehicle Height 1530 mm 1420 mm
Wheelbase Size 2870 mm 2710 mm
Fuel Consumption Overall 15.7 L/100km 9 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 72 L 62 L
